Seller's Description

INPUTS 2 balanced (XLR) and 2 unbalanced (RCA) INPUT IMPEDANCE 30 kOhm (balancedunbalanced) INPUT SENSITIVITY 2.0 VRMS (for max output) GAIN +30 dB XLR PIN LAYOUT PIN1-ground, PIN2-positive signal, PIN3-negative signal (when use RCA input you need to insert XLR shorting plug!) POWER OUTPUT 2×4502×8002×1.350 W at 842 Ohm (peak power output: 600 W at 8 Ohm) FREQUENCY RESPONSE 20 Hz to 20 kHz, +- 0 dB; (DC to 300 kHz, -3 dB) Distortion THD 0.03% IMD 0.03% SPEED Rise and Settling time < 450 ns Slew rate 1.500 Vus (Amplification stages) SIGNAL TO NOISE RATIO > 120 dB (unweig... read more

About Karan Acoustics

Karan Acoustics traces its roots to Serbia, where founder Milan Karan established the brand in the 1990s after building a reputation for repairing complex electronics, including obsolete medical equipment. Handcrafting components in a small, dedicated facility, the company embodies a boutique tradition of meticulous, made-to-order audio gear that has earned global distribution despite its isolated origins. Since 1999, Hermes Netherlands has handled marketing and support in Benelux and Scandinavia, underscoring Karan's commitment to direct, personal delivery of his designs.

The brand specializes in high-end solid-state amplification and source components, with a focus on power amplifiers, preamplifiers, integrated amplifiers, and phono stages. Standouts include dual-mono power amps like the KAS 600, which scales from 600 to 1800 watts, and the Master Collection series offering single- or dual-chassis options for preamps and mono amps. Precision engineering targets transparency and power, often featuring massive, hand-built chassis without venturing into speakers, turntables, DACs, headphones, or cables.

Positioned firmly in the ultra-high-end market, Karan Acoustics commands respect among discerning audiophiles for its unflinching sonic performance—delivering detail, dynamics, and neutrality that rival the best. Reviewers praise its seamless integration and build quality, with prices like $10,500 for the KA I 180 integrated reflecting its niche as a collector's choice for those seeking reference-level solid-state refinement over mass-market appeal.
